## Runbook: TideGlance Widget Refresh

Before promoting a TideGlance build, verify that the harbor-data cache has been warmed within the last hour, as stale tables render as blank panels in the Brinholm region. Restart the renderer only after the cache check passes, and confirm the version banner matches the release candidate. The active service configuration is listed below.

deployment values, kajep-kageg:
[praix]
host = praix.paliqcorp.corp
user = praix_svc
database = praix_prod

Handing off config hot-reload in Perchline. Watcher is inotify-based; SIGHUP fallback for NFS mounts. Reload is atomic — old config kept until new one validates. Don't touch the debounce timer, it papers over editor temp files. If the reload daemon wedges and you need the admin console, the recovery passphrase is below.

strongbox words: wenix-ulador

**Runbook: Recon Job Account Recovery**

The Coppervale inventory reconciliation job runs nightly under the `recon-svc` account. If the account is disabled after three failed ledger syncs, do not recreate it — downstream audits break. Pause the job queue, clear the failure counter, then restore access through the recovery console. The console will prompt for the passphrase shown below.

vault phrase of bagaf-kajeg = jorath-feniel-briir-siliel-ralix

Welcome to the Contrast Audit team at Pellwick Studio. Each quarter we run a full color-contrast accessibility audit across the Lumabrand component library, checking every text and icon pairing against our internal thresholds. New members should start with the audit spreadsheet owned by the Foreground squad and flag any ratio below 4.5:1. Results are stored in the Tintvault archive, which requires the team recovery credentials for first-time access. The passphrase you will need to unlock the archive appears directly below.

unlock words, fajog-yagag: belix-ralwyn-quenys-druix-tamion